2. A Highly Experienced Financial Team
Identifying eligible R&D activities is only half of a successful claim. You also need to accurately determine the expenditure associated with those activities. Rimon has a dedicated Financial Team comprising Chartered Accountants and financial experts who specialise in quantifying R&D activities. This can include salaries, contractors, cloud infrastructure, software, materials, prototypes, overheads and other eligible expenditure.
Calculating R&D expenditure is more complex than adding up everything spent on a project. Employees and contractors may perform both R&D and non-R&D work, while shared costs may need to be apportioned. Our Financial Team works to establish a clear and supportable connection between eligible activities and expenditure, helping capture costs that may otherwise be missed while ensuring there is a sound basis for the final claim.

5. Deep Understanding of AusIndustry and ATO Legislation
The R&D Tax Incentive involves two regulatory bodies, each responsible for different aspects of a claim. AusIndustry assesses whether activities satisfy the R&D eligibility requirements, while the ATO focuses on the financial and tax aspects, including whether expenditure has been correctly calculated and substantiated. A strong claim needs to satisfy both.
Rimon’s team structure reflects these requirements. Our Technical Team focuses on the AusIndustry eligibility framework, including core and supporting R&D activities, technical uncertainty and systematic progression of work. Our Financial Team focuses on eligible expenditure, apportionment and substantiation. Crucially, the two sides need to align: eligible expenditure must relate back to eligible R&D activities and be appropriately supported.

7. Optimising Your Legitimate Claim While Minimising Risk
Two major mistakes businesses can make are underclaiming and overclaiming. Underclaiming can mean overlooking eligible activities or expenditure, while overclaiming can mean including items that cannot be adequately supported and increasing compliance risk.
